Conservation Programs Available

FSA is opening signup for the Conservation Reserve Program (CRP). The general signup runs from December 9, 2019 to February 28, 2020. The continuous signup runs from December 9, 2019 and is ongoing.

Natural Resources Conservation Service (NRCS) is  also accepting applications for the 2020 crop year for the Environmental Quality Incentives Program (EQIP) and Conservation Stewardship Program (CSP). 

NRCS programs offer funding to help producers make improvements to their operation that will also positively impact our natural resources such as water, air, and soil. CSP and EQIP are cost share programs that can help cover the cost of converting to a more environmentally friendly practice, either on a whole farm or field by field basis.
